August 26, 20205 yr Quote Jack Brewer, a former NFL player who spent one season with the Philadelphia Eagles, was scheduled to speak Wednesday at the Republican National Convention. But Brewer was absent from an updated list of speakers released by organizers Wednesday morning, after NPR reported on insider trading charges that were filed against him earlier this month. He also wasn’t mentioned in a Wednesday press briefing about the convention. Brewer did not respond to a request for comment. A spokesperson for the Trump campaign would not say if Brewer would speak Wednesday night.
